Wall slipping behavior of foam with nanoparticle-armored bubbles and its flow resistance factor in cracks

In this work, wall slipping behavior of foam with nanoparticle-armored bubbles was first studied in a capillary tube and the novel multiphase foam was characterized by a slipping law. A crack model with a cuboid geometry was then used to compare with the foam slipping results from the capillary tube...
